Job Description

We are looking for a skilled IT Project Manager to oversee and deliver complex technology and business projects in a highly regulated industry. This long-term contract position requires a detail-oriented individual with a strong background in enterprise IT, exceptional organizational abilities, and expertise in project management methodologies. Based in Albuquerque, New Mexico, this role offers the opportunity to collaborate with diverse teams and drive impactful solutions.
Responsibilities:
  • Lead the end-to-end lifecycle of IT and business projects, ensuring successful planning, execution, and delivery.
  • Oversee project scope, timelines, budgets, risks, and documentation to align with organizational objectives.
  • Collaborate closely with IT teams, business stakeholders, and external vendors to achieve project goals.
  • Facilitate productive meetings, gather requirements, and guide decision-making processes.
  • Provide regular updates on project progress, potential challenges, and milestones to senior leadership.
  • Promote adherence to organizational standards and contribute to the improvement of processes.
  • Support the transition from Microsoft Project to Jira, ensuring smooth adoption and proper utilization.
  • Implement best practices and methodologies, including Waterfall, Agile, or hybrid approaches.
  • Address challenges proactively and maintain high-quality standards throughout project execution.
Other duties as needed
